Hello All

My employer just completed the AD process and it’s time to file for PERM which, as per my lawyer, takes 4 months. My 6 year H1B visa expires end of September 2013. By the time PERM is cleared and I149 is filed and approved, I would have passed way beyond my H1B visa period. What can I do to avoid leaving the country while my GC application is in process? If the PERM is cleared before my visa expires, can I extend the H1B visa? Any suggestions would be helpful. Thank you

highly unlikely that your PREM will be approved before SEP13. Process is a black box, and if you application stuck in random audit then further delay. And in PREM thr is no premium processing.

But if everything is in you favor, and somehow you get PREM before SEP, then you will be able to apply for H1b extension (1yr).

I would advise to talk to your manager and make alternate plans ASAP. Some companies allow you to work remotely or from an office in another country for the time being to support yourself.

You may be able to change your status to a visitor visa (but cant work), but it is still unlikely that you will be able to avoid leaving unless you were extremely lucky. you should speak to your attorney to see what options they can find for you.
